As I use Verizon service, I don't bother with any of the Dell Mobile Broadband stuff beyond the basic driver - I just use the Verizon/SmithMicro VZ Access Manager for mobile broadband. Persumably the other carriers offer something similar.
If your system also has separate cards and you don't use the mobile broadband or GPS functions, you can just turn the card off (in the BIOS or with QuickSet).
